How to find Non-Primary and Primary bucket copies on the peer nodes ?

Bucket locations are specified in your indexes.conf file(s).
Replicate buckets are in the same locations on another node, but their names start with "rb_" instead of "db_".
I'm not sure how to tell where the replicate is for a given primary bucket.
